About The Ophthalmological Foundation of the
Philippines (OFPHIL)
A non-stock, not-for-profit private organization established in 1989
by a group of civic-spirited citizens of the Philippines, Japan and the USA, who share a
common goal of improving the standard of vision care among the poor in the Philippines.
Our Vision
The development of the Philippines as a center of excellence
for total vision care in Asia and accessible to both rich and poor
Our Mission
- Develop modern, world-class eye diagnostic treatment centers that provide state-of-the-art
technology and patient care, in partnership with selected qualified hospitals,
eye clinics and other ophthalmological organizations.
- sProvide technical and training assistance services in clinic design,
administration, management and staff training, and medical equipment procurement.
- Invite Filipino and foreign ophthalmologists who are recognized specialists
in their fields to teach and train the medical staff of these eye centers.
- Support fellowship programs abroad for young qualified Filipino ophthalmologists.
- Raise funds for our different projects from local and international sources.
- Utilize these eye centers to fight preventable blindness particularly among the poor
